Sprinkler System Water Removal Cost in Burlington, WA

The cost of Sprinkler System Water Removal in Burlington, WA, varies based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on typical price ranges for the services listed below. Keep in mind that ex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ment $200 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Amount of water extracted, equipment used
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, duration of drying process
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$200 – $1,000 Type of products used, extent of contamination
Restoration and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Scope of repairs, materials used
Emergency Response (24/7) $500 – $2,000 Time of day, urgency of situation

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and flexible payment options to fit your needs.
